ENSURE THAT THE SAMPLE COMPARTMENT DOOR REMAINS CLOSED OVER THE DURATION
OF THE TEST. THE AUTOSAMPLER WILL NOT OPERATE IF THE DOOR IS OPEN AND THE TEST
TIMING WILL BE INACCURATE AS A RESULT.
Figure 2.33 Test screen graphing real-time data aquisition.
The Test screen displays the Response graph, temperature controls as well as the autosampler
status.
2.2.6 Shut Down Procedure
1. At the end of the procedure set in the Test Timeline, the software will finish the test and
automatically export the experiment data into a .csv file and TraceDrawer (.txt) file. The data
files are saved in a folder specified by the test date and start time under
C:\Documents\OpenSPR\TestResults.
2. If no more tests are to be run within the day with the same running buffer, the system must
be flushed with DI water. To do this, place the inlet tubing into a container of DI water. Restart
the software, load previous reference spectra, and select Automatic fill of flow cell. This will
start the pump at maximum speed. Allow the pump to run for at least 15 minutes.
3. You may store the instrument with the Sensor Chip installed and filled with DI water. This is
convenient for the next experiment as the previous Sensor Chip can be left in place while
priming the instrument. The instrument can also be stored while filled with air, as long as it
has been sufficiently flushed with DI.
4. At this time it is recommended that the steps outlined in the Instrument Maintenance and
Cleaning section be followed to clean the system and ensure that future tests are not
contaminated by solutions used in past experiments.
